Biografia umelca
The Emerging Vision of Andrea Cominelli
Andrea Cominelli is a contemporary artist whose work resonates with a quiet intensity, a thoughtful exploration of form and color that belies a deeply personal artistic journey. While biographical details remain intentionally sparse – Cominelli preferring to let the artwork speak for itself – his presence on platforms like ArtsDot signals a growing recognition within the art world. He isn’t an artist defined by grand narratives or public persona, but rather one whose impact is felt through the evocative power of his paintings. His emergence represents a shift towards introspective artistry, where technical skill serves as a vehicle for emotional and philosophical inquiry. Cominelli's work doesn’t shout; it whispers, inviting viewers into a contemplative space where meaning unfolds gradually, shaped by individual perception.A Dialogue with Color and Texture
Cominelli’s artistic practice is fundamentally rooted in an intimate relationship with materials. He masterfully employs oil paint, often building layers of color to create rich, textured surfaces that possess a tactile quality. This isn't simply about representation; it’s about the very *act* of painting – the physicality of applying pigment, the subtle blending of hues, and the resulting interplay of light and shadow. His canvases are frequently abstract or semi-abstract, eschewing literal depictions in favor of exploring the emotional resonance of color itself. One can discern influences from Abstract Expressionism, particularly in the gestural application of paint, yet Cominelli’s work possesses a unique restraint, a deliberate control that prevents it from becoming purely chaotic. There's a sense of controlled energy within each piece, as if emotions are being carefully channeled rather than unleashed. The artist often works with palettes that evoke natural landscapes – muted earth tones, deep blues and greens, and occasional bursts of vibrant color – suggesting a connection to the organic world without directly replicating it.Influences and Artistic Development
Pinpointing specific influences on Cominelli’s work is challenging, as his style feels distinctly personal. However, one can detect echoes of Mark Rothko's color field paintings in the atmospheric quality of his compositions, and a kinship with Gerhard Richter’s abstract explorations of texture and light. It’s likely that Cominelli draws inspiration not from specific artists but rather from broader movements – the post-war emphasis on subjective experience, the exploration of materiality within Abstract Expressionism, and the conceptual rigor of Minimalism. His development appears to be a gradual refinement of these influences, moving towards an increasingly sophisticated understanding of color theory and composition. Early works may have exhibited more overt gestural energy, while later pieces demonstrate a greater focus on subtle tonal variations and carefully constructed forms. This evolution suggests a continuous process of self-discovery, where the artist is constantly pushing the boundaries of his own technique and exploring new avenues of expression.Themes and Interpretations
While Cominelli avoids explicit statements about the meaning of his work, certain themes consistently emerge across his oeuvre. A sense of solitude and introspection pervades many of his paintings, suggesting a contemplation of inner states and emotional landscapes. The use of layered color can be interpreted as representing the complexities of human experience – the interplay of joy and sorrow, hope and despair.- His work often evokes a feeling of timelessness, transcending specific cultural or historical contexts.
- The absence of recognizable forms encourages viewers to engage with the artwork on a purely emotional level, allowing for personal interpretations.
- Recurring motifs – subtle gradations of color, blurred edges, and textured surfaces – create a sense of atmosphere and depth.
